Your Phone is Now a Planetarium
Not long ago, identifying celestial objects required star charts, a telescope, and a lot of patience. Today, your smartphone can do the heavy lifting. Modern stargazing apps use your phone's built-in GPS and compass to know exactly where you are and which
direction you're pointing. They then overlay a map of the stars, planets, and constellations onto your screen in real time. This technology, often called augmented reality (AR), turns the overwhelming expanse of the night sky into a user-friendly, interactive guide. Simply point your phone towards a bright object, and the app will tell you precisely what you are looking at, whether it’s the planet Jupiter or a distant star.
Picking Your Digital Guide
The number of astronomy apps can be daunting, but a few stand out for their beginner-friendly design and powerful features. Many excellent options are available for free. Star Walk 2 is often recommended for beginners due to its appealing visuals and ease of use. SkyView Lite is another fantastic choice, celebrated for its AR feature that uses your camera to overlay information directly onto the night sky. For those who want a more realistic and data-rich experience, Stellarium Mobile offers a free version that packs a punch, acting as a full-featured planetarium in your hand. Most of these free apps are supported by occasional ads, but they provide more than enough functionality to get you started on your cosmic journey.
Finding the Gas Giants: Jupiter and Saturn
Jupiter and Saturn are two of the most rewarding objects for a beginner to spot. As the two largest planets in our solar system, they shine brightly in the night sky. Jupiter is often the brightest object after the Moon and Venus, appearing as a brilliant, steady light. Saturn is typically a little fainter with a distinct yellowish-white hue. With a stargazing app, finding them is effortless. Open your app, search for Jupiter or Saturn, and an arrow will guide you. As you move your phone, the app will lead you directly to their location in the sky. Even without a telescope, knowing that the bright dot you’re looking at is a giant world hundreds of millions of kilometres away is a truly special feeling.
Catching a Star That Moves: The ISS
One of the most thrilling sights in the night sky isn't a planet, but a human achievement: the International Space Station (ISS). Orbiting Earth at over 28,000 kilometres per hour, the ISS is visible to the naked eye as a very bright, fast-moving point of light, similar to an airplane but without flashing lights. Because it moves so quickly, timing is everything. This is where dedicated apps become essential. Apps like ISS Detector or NASA’s official Spot The Station app will send you notifications minutes before the station is due to pass over your specific location. They provide the exact time, duration, and path it will take across your sky, ensuring you don’t miss the 3 to 5-minute window to see it glide by.
Simple Tips for the Best View
You don't need a pristine, dark-sky location to get started, especially for bright objects like Jupiter, Saturn, and the ISS. While light pollution in cities can hide fainter stars, these targets are often bright enough to cut through the haze. For the best experience, find a spot with a clear view of the sky, away from the direct glare of streetlights. Give your eyes about 15-20 minutes to adjust to the darkness; this will help you see much more. Many apps also feature a red-light mode, which helps preserve your night vision while you look at your screen. Check a weather app for clear skies before you head out, and most importantly, be patient. The universe has been there for a long time, and it's waiting for you to look up.
